Adidas Harden Vol. 3

The previous iterations of Adidas Harden were one of the best-selling models in the previous years, and it doesn’t come as a surprise that the Adidas Harden Vol. 3 is one of 2019’s highest-rated model. Inspired by James Harden’s on-court style, the shoe’s upper has been completely redesigned. The designers got rid of the midfoot cage and placed an elastic strap over the metatarsal area to give you a beautiful, comfortable shoe. The Harden Vol. 3 is made from a quality knit that feels supportive and strong and comes in various fun colorways to complement your outfits. The cushioning system in this shoe stands out from the crowds. It features a low-heel-to toe offset and Boost to give you protection and balance on the court, and an incredible amount of bounceback. The outsole features a tightly packed herringbone traction. In terms of fit, the Harden Vol. 3 features a supportive internal heel counter, a locked-down feel and a flat base.

Jordan Why Not ZerO.2

Released on 10th January 2019, this Russell Westbrook’s signature model features a blend of inventive engineering and wild design. It also comes in a series of flashy colorways. It’s a basketball shoe both players and fans can get behind. A unique feature is the “0” traction pattern meant to match Westbrook’s jersey number. The shoe grips both indoor and outdoor courts well. To provide excellent support and lockdown, there’s Phylon in the heel. This model also provides forefoot impact protection. If cushion and feedback from a shoe is your thing, you will love the ZerO.2. The upper is made of comfortable and durable mesh and knit. Speaking of fit, the Zero.2 fits true to size. For lockdown, you get an overlay of panels/straps that wrap around your foot at the forefoot, midfoot and rear. The rear and midfoot heel support comes from the TPU plates that are part of the FlightSpeed system. Overall, this shoe is comfortable, quick and supportive.

Nike Lebron 16

Made in collaboration with one of the best athlete of our generation and the longest-running active player with a signature sneaker, LeBron James’ 16th signature shoe packs vital updates in terms of flexibility, weight and fit. The result is an overall high-performing shoe that can be worn both on the court and as a casual outdoor sneaker. The Battleknit 2.0 is the biggest change in this shoe released in September 2018. It is made from stronger and more reliable fibers meant to keep you locked in no matter of the speed or way you move. Somehow, the shoe still manages to allow customization and flexibility for the ultimate fit. The tongue has an expandable gusset with a pull tab at the heel that allows easy entry. You don’t have to worry about fit or rubbing issue, thanks to the collapsible tongue. The cushion has a blend of Zoom Air and Max Air shock absorption to give you amazing impact protection and internal Achilles support. The bottom features an improved herringbone-patterned outsole. To avoid picking up dirt, the lines are further apart. This means less cleaning and more playtime. We recommend this shoe to powerful and explosive wing players.

Adidas Dame 5

An early contender for the best all-round basketball shoe of 2019 , the Adidas Dame 5 Damian Lillard’s latest signature shoe, and also his best. It was released early this year on 1st February 2019 and utilizes herringbone traction from heel to toe similar to the rest of Adidas’ current basketball shoes lineup. What sets the Dame 5 from the others is the unique implementation of the pattern. Every line of the pattern is thick and widely spaced apart. This is meant to make it harder for dust to clog up the outsole if you happen to play on street courts. The traction is just as reliable outdoors making the sneakers a solid outdoor option. With this shoe, you also get amazing lockdown, an impeccable fit and great cushioning. You’ll enjoy plenty of impact protection without feeling instability or loss of court feel. The inside is generously padded. There are currently 2 material options for Dame 5, leather and mesh. The mesh versions is slightly lighter in weight than its leather counterpart. The 2 options provide 2 different on-foot experiences without feeling like they’re different shoes. The best thing about Dame 5 is that it comes at an affordable price.

Under Armour Curry 6

UA’s HOVR cushioning has a reputation for maximizing comfort underneath the entire foot to offer a nice blend of court feel and impact protection. This model released on 4th January 2019 is a true engineering marvel and has something for everyone. The Curry 6 has gained more praises by sneaker reviewers than its predecessor. If you’re a fan of the low profile feel of the past Curry models, you will love the Curry 6.  The HOVR has been tweaked to be more subdued than the running version. In this model, UA used knit full-length, from heel to toe.  Sporting a circular traction pattern on the lateral side, the translucent rubber outsole provides excellent multi-direction grip and manages to add a nice flourish of color. The shoe is well-ventilated to ensure that your feet remain dry even after a long training or playing session. Traction and stability are 2 features this line most known for and this model doesn’t disappoint. The flex grooves are carved into the outsole to provide natural motion, and the base is fairly flat and wide for stability.
